Flydubai launches new routes to Entebbe, Bujumbura


(MENAFN) Dubai-based flydubai's announced it has launched a new service to Entebbe and Bujumbura, with daily direct flights to Entebbe, and three flights a week to Bujumbura, thus doubling the carrier's presence in Africa to 12 destinations, Gulf News reported.

The carrier said that it will be offering economy and business classes as well as cargo services to Entebbe, one of Africa's leading commercial centers, thus facilitating the flow of tourism and business between Uganda and the UAE.

Meanwhile, the airline believes that the rich biodiversity of Burundi will attract tourists from around the carrier's network as well as offering a great opportunity for this country to strengthen its trade ties through Flydubai 80 destinations, which they offer.

With the lauch of these new services, Flydubai becomes the first national carrier from the UAE to fly to Burundi and Uganda, which is in line with its commitment to opening up underserved markets to the globe.
